Ovarian cancer awareness month 2023
Tabled by Jim Shannon (Democratic Unionist Party)
22 signatures
The motion
That this House notes Ovarian cancer awareness month that takes place in March 2023; further notes that over 7,000 women are diagnosed each year in the UK and over 4,000 women lose their lives each year, which is 11 women everyday; highlights that if diagnosed at the earliest stage, nine in 10 women will survive, but two-thirds of women are diagnosed late, when the cancer is harder to treat; further highlights that nearly half of GPs mistakenly believe symptoms only present in the later stages of the disease, and less than a third of women in the UK are confident they know the symptoms; notes the incredible work by MacMillan and Cancer Research in raising awareness on what to look out for in terms of ovarian cancer diagnosis; and thanks MacMillan for all they do for those families who need support.
